What Is a "Burner" Phone?

Burner phones are inexpensive, prepaid devices without contracts, designed to be discarded when no longer needed. Popularized in series like Breaking Bad and The Wire, where characters use them to evade detection, the term "burner" evokes destroying evidence. However, legitimate users appreciate their simplicity and disposability.

Enhancing Privacy

A primary advantage is anonymity. In our connected world, a prepaid phone with an unlinked SIM provides a layer of privacy that criminals exploit—but so can anyone. We've recommended them for scenarios like online dating, where sharing your main number early risks unwanted contact. Simply dispose of the burner if needed.

They're also ideal for anonymous tips to authorities or protecting your identity in sensitive situations.

Emergency Preparedness

In many countries, emergency calls (e.g., 911 in the US or 000 in Australia) work on any phone with network coverage, even without an active plan. For disasters like floods or wildfires, a charged burner phone serves as a reliable backup.

Unlike power-hungry smartphones, basic "dumb" phones last weeks on standby or offer hundreds of hours of talk time. As experts in preparedness, we keep one in our emergency kits—it's a simple step that could be lifesaving.

Avoiding Spam and Robocalls

Spam calls and texts plague primary numbers. Use a burner for services like rentals or online sales (e.g., Craigslist), shielding your real line from marketers.

Alternatives to a Burner Phone

No need for a second device? Opt for a secondary SIM in your primary phone for a disposable number. Or try apps like Burner, which generate virtual numbers that forward to your main line, keeping it private. Android users have excellent virtual number apps available.
